Can't beat their happy hour prices on clams, oysters and shrimp. Happened upon this little cape cod decorate gem while walking on a Saturday. Perused their menu and saw they offered 1.00 clams, oysters and shrimp. The regions listed for the seafood were familiar so I gave them a try. On this visit I didn't order much outside of what I mentioned above. All items came out fast. Clams were littleneck. Briny and bitesize. If you're a clam lover, you'll want 12 of these. The oyster were James River. Those not familiar, that's VA. They were small in size but, deep/meaty on the inside. They were good as well. You may want to order more of these as well. Also on this visit I had the shrimp cocktail. It's your average cold shrimp cocktail. Size of shrimp was L/XL. Outside of the seafood, I had a somewhat underwhelming beer. It was Modelo on tap. I thought it would be much crisper but, it wasn't. Maybe it was the end of the keg? I did not look at any other items on the menu as I was more focused on the seafood task at hand and sips.
